PEDEN, Justice.
Plaintiff was a "side-rider" or passenger in an ambulance that ran into the side of a large truck in an intersection as the truck was going east on Market Street on a green traffic light. The ambulance had entered the intersection going south on Federal Road on a red traffic light, and each vehicle had been proceeding straight ahead. The trial judge ruled that the ambulance was on an authorized emergency trip at the time.
